A kind of fire preventing and heat insulating building material
Technical field
The present invention relates to technical field of board processing, and in particular to a kind of fire preventing and heat insulating building material.
Background technology
The material used in architectural engineering is referred to as construction material.Construction material can be divided into structural material, ornament materials With some proprietary materials.It is preferable not enough currently used for the construction material outside in exterior wall, more particularly, to energy-saving and environmental protection, fire prevention, Field of thermal insulation row are can not to fully meet various needs.Most external wall of building materials is generally larger with proportion now, derivative Coefficient is big, and insulation, fire protecting performance is poor, and material requested does not have the shortcomings of feature of environmental protection, and be not easy there are constructing operation Problem.
The content of the invention
In view of the above-mentioned problems of the prior art, the present invention provides a kind of fire preventing and heat insulating building material, the construction material Fire prevention, good heat insulating, and there is environmental protection.
The present invention provides the raw material composition of a kind of fire preventing and heat insulating building material, including following parts by weight:
60-80 parts of haydite;
45-60 parts of gypsum;
10-25 parts of magnesia powder;
6-10 parts of toughener;
4-8 parts of interface modifier;
3-5 parts of fire retardant;
20-30 parts of rubber grain;
2-6 parts of curing agent;
60-80 parts of cement;
40-80 parts of quartz sand;
30-40 parts of carborundum;
10-15 parts of polyurethane;
10-25 parts of glass microballoon.
Raw material composition including following parts by weight:
65 parts of haydite;
50 parts of gypsum;
15 parts of magnesia powder;
8 parts of toughener;
7 parts of interface modifier;
4 parts of fire retardant;
25 parts of rubber grain;
4 parts of curing agent;
71 parts of cement;
55 parts of quartz sand;
35 parts of carborundum;
12 parts of polyurethane;
15 parts of glass microballoon.
The fire retardant is ammonium polyphosphate.
For traditional construction material, of the invention has preferable fire retardant performance, but also with guarantor The effect of temperature.
